Java的多態

繼承是多態的實現基礎 引用類型轉換: 1.向上類型轉換(隱式/自動類型轉換),是小類型到大類型的轉換。 如:Dog dog=new Dog();Animal animal=dog;//正確,自動類型提升,向上類型轉換 2.向下類型轉換(強制類型轉換),是大類型到小類型的轉換(存在風險,溢出) 如:Dog dog1=(Dog)animal;//向下類型轉換 3.instanceof運算符,來解決
相關文章
相關標籤/搜索